Advancements in technology unveil a myriad of electrical and electronic breakthroughs geared towards efficiently harnessing limited resources to meet human energy demands. The optimization of hybrid solar PV panels and pumped hydro energy supply systems plays a pivotal role in utilizing natural resources effectively. This initiative not only benefits humanity but also fosters environmental sustainability. The study investigated the design optimization of these hybrid systems, focusing on understanding solar radiation patterns, identifying geographical influences on solar radiation, formulating a mathematical model for system optimization, and determining the optimal configuration of PV panels and pumped hydro storage. Through a comparative analysis approach and eight weeks of data collection, the study addressed key research questions related to solar radiation patterns and optimal system design. The findings highlighted regions with heightened solar radiation levels, showcasing substantial potential for power generation and emphasizing the system's efficiency. Optimizing system design significantly boosted power generation, promoted renewable energy utilization, and enhanced energy storage capacity. The study underscored the benefits of optimizing hybrid solar PV panels and pumped hydro energy supply systems for sustainable energy usage. Optimizing the design of solar PV panels and pumped hydro energy supply systems as examined across diverse climatic conditions in a developing country, not only enhances power generation but also improves the integration of renewable energy sources and boosts energy storage capacities, particularly beneficial for less economically prosperous regions. Additionally, the study provides valuable insights for advancing energy research in economically viable areas. Recommendations included conducting site-specific assessments, utilizing advanced modeling tools, implementing regular maintenance protocols, and enhancing communication among system components.

Structural Design Engineer – Bridges, Tunnels and Special Structures.
AECOM Middle East – Abu Dhabi
AECOM | Nov 2014 to Present
Worked in designing post tensioned box girder bridges for EXPO 2020 in
Dubai, UAE. Designed the superstructure and substructure of more than 25
prestressed post tensioned concrete bridges. The number of spans varied
from two to twelve spans. The bridges had different cross sections, depth,
width, cantilevers, curvature, construction stages and variations depending
on the bridge functionality. Most of the bridges I have designed were box
girder bridges. I have also designed multiple I-girder pre-tensioned bridges.
The structural analysis was done using Midas Civil software in accordance to
AASHTO, and most of the modeling was done using spine models.
Nonetheless, I have modeled different bridges using the grillage modeling
approach mentioned on EC. Hambly Bridge Deck Behavior.
Designed the bridge bearings and determined the load capacities, rotations,
and movements required for bearings. In addition, I have grouped the bridge
bearings and tabulated the information on the drawings in accordance with
AASHTO.
Designed the bridge transverse cross section depending on the cross section
width, number of cells, cantilever length, pedestrian walkways and
embedded utilities.
Designed bridge diaphragms using the flexural member method and using
the strut and tie approach.
Assisted Senior Engineers in determining the required number of spans,
bridge type, and construction stages depending on location, existing utilities,
and space availability.
Designed miscellaneous elements such as bearings and Expansion
movement joints.
Coordinated with other utility teams such as potable water, high
voltage, low voltage, sewer lines, highway, and geotechnical to assure a
clash free and safe design.
Done Quantity take off and BOQ preparation for tender document release.
Worked in verification of steel pedestrian bridge with steel columns and
reinforced concrete pile cap and piles. All the checks were verified based on
the on AASHTO 2014 code requirements.

Delivered the preliminary and detailed design packages of the vertical
precast shafts and underground cast in-situ chambers used for gravity
sewerage project in compliance to Euro code. The precast shafts had an
internal diameter of 2 and 3 meters, and the chambers had a depth ranging
from 30 to 60 m and they had different shapes and hydraulic purposes that
needed special structural detailing. CIRIA guide was used to check the
elements against the effects of early thermal cracking. In addition, I
Coordinated with other AECOM offices including water, tunneling, and
geotechnical teams located in UK, Qatar and UAE to insure all the
information are shared accurately and on time.
I designed two sewage pumping stations that included deep. The work done
involved providing safe economical design that meets the requirements of
ACI318. The chambers were designed considering earth lateral loads,
surcharge, wind, operational loads, and allowable bearing pressure. The
project involved high level of coordination with other mechanical,
electrical, geotechnical and architectural teams.

WORK EXPERIENCE (Tunnels, Culverts and Protection slabs)
Verified the design of an underpass and adjacent retaining walls. The
underpass and retaining walls verification included checking the service and
ultimate capacities. In addition, sliding, overturning, and bearing capacity
were carried over to make sure verified structures meet all the requirements
of the client and AASHTO 2014 code requirements.
Delivered the detailed design package of various tunnels and culverts in
compliance to AASHTO LRFD code. The cast in situ bottom slab, top slap,
internal columns/walls and external walls with different dimensions were
checked against the effects of early thermal cracking, serviceability check,
flexural and shear design. I coordinated with geotechnical, highway,
electrical and mechanical teams located in the same office to insure all the
required information are obtained to satisfy the design and client’s
requirements.
Worked in the preliminary and detailed design of multiple protection slabs
with different spans to protect existing or future utilities from any additional
loads in future.
